Commercial Pavement Repair in San Diego County, CA
Commercial pavement repair services address the maintenance and restoration needs of existing asphalt or concrete surfaces on commercial properties, such as parking lots, driveways, walkways, and loading areas. These projects typically involve fixing cracks, potholes, surface deterioration, and other damage caused by weather, heavy traffic, or aging materials. Property owners often seek these services to improve safety, enhance curb appeal, and prevent further deterioration that could lead to costly repairs or liability issues.
Before requesting commercial pavement repair, property owners usually want to understand the scope of work involved, the types of repairs suitable for their surfaces, and the condition of the existing pavement. It’s helpful to assess whether the surface requires patching, crack sealing, resurfacing, or complete replacement. Clarifying the extent of damage and the expected outcomes can ensure the repair process aligns with the property's needs and minimizes disruptions to daily operations.

Common Commercial Pavement Repair Jobs
Crack Repair - addressing surface cracks to prevent further pavement deterioration.
Pothole Patching - filling potholes to restore a smooth and safe driving surface.
Surface Resurfacing - applying a new layer to improve pavement appearance and durability.
Joint and Seam Repair - sealing joints to prevent water intrusion and cracking.
Overlay Services - adding a new surface layer to extend pavement lifespan.
Pavement Restoration - restoring damaged areas for safety and functional performance.
Commercial Pavement Repair Questions
What types of commercial pavement repairs are available? Services include crack filling, pothole patching, surface sealing, and full-depth repairs to restore pavement condition.
How can I tell if my pavement needs repair? Signs include visible cracks, potholes, uneven surfaces, and water pooling, indicating deterioration that requires attention.
Are repairs suitable for all types of commercial pavements? Repairs can be tailored for asphalt, concrete, or other pavement surfaces commonly used in commercial properties.
What benefits do pavement repairs provide? Proper repairs improve safety, extend pavement lifespan, and enhance the appearance of commercial property exteriors.
